About

Safeer Alam is a scholar working on Genetics, Agronomy and Crop Science and General Agricultural and Biological Sciences. According to data from OpenAlex, Safeer Alam has authored 43 papers receiving a total of 272 indexed citations (citations by other indexed papers that have themselves been cited), including 18 papers in Genetics, 16 papers in Agronomy and Crop Science and 8 papers in General Agricultural and Biological Sciences. Recurrent topics in Safeer Alam's work include Genetic and phenotypic traits in livestock (18 papers), Livestock Management and Performance Improvement (13 papers) and Agricultural Economics and Practices (8 papers). Safeer Alam is often cited by papers focused on Genetic and phenotypic traits in livestock (18 papers), Livestock Management and Performance Improvement (13 papers) and Agricultural Economics and Practices (8 papers). Safeer Alam collaborates with scholars based in India, Bangladesh and Oman. Safeer Alam's co-authors include K.M. Zahidul Islam, Nazir Ahmad Ganai, Syed Shanaz, Abdullah Al Masud, Md. Alamgir Hossain, Ambreen Hamadani, Nusrat Nabi Khan, Syed Mudasir Ahmad, Agus Rizal Ardy Hariandy Hamid and Zafar A. Shah and has published in prestigious journals such as SHILAP Revista de lepidopterología, Scientific Reports and Small Ruminant Research.

Rankless uses publication and citation data sourced from OpenAlex, an open and comprehensive bibliographic database. While OpenAlex provides broad and valuable coverage of the global research landscape, it—like all bibliographic datasets—has inherent limitations. These include incomplete records, variations in author disambiguation, differences in journal indexing, and delays in data updates. As a result, some metrics and network relationships displayed in Rankless may not fully capture the entirety of a scholar's output or impact.
